Tech Racho エンジニアの「?」を「!」に。

CakePHP Delimiter must not be alphanumeric or backslash

CakePHP で validateやsetをしたときに、以下のようなエラーが出ることがあります。

Warning (2): preg_match() [function.preg-match]: Delimiter must not be alphanumeric or backslash [CORE\cake\libs\model\model.php, line 2567]

これは、notEmptyをnotEntpyのようにtypoしたときなど、バリデーションルールが存在しないときに出てくるようです。
こんなことで30分も無駄遣いしないように気をつけましょう。

CONTACT

TechRachoでは、パートナーシップをご検討いただける方からの
ご連絡をお待ちしております。ぜひお気軽にご意見・ご相談ください。